Jeong Jeom-gyu, CEO of Genbody Inc., a company that manufactures diagnostic medical devices, donated 50 million won to his alma mater, Geochang Daeseong High School. Genbody, established in 2012, was the first to develop and commercialize a diagnostic kit during the Zika virus outbreak in 2015 and has been instrumental in the COVID-19 pandemic by developing rapid diagnostic kits. Last year, it established a production plant for diagnostic antigens and antibodies in Geochang County.
